Federal and private student loan ABS are among the few securitization sectors trading wider, under pressure from imminent student loan forgiveness policies. While both sectors offer attractive spread pick up above other ABS asset classes, the softness points to mounting concerns that loan forgiveness will not only impact FFELP loans, but private deals too, which depend on a student’s willingness to refinance their federal loans.

Acciona Energia, the Spanish renewable energy company, is due to price its IPO at €26.73 a share, the bottom of the initial range, having closed order books on Tuesday afternoon, according to sources close to the transaction.

RAG Stiftung, the foundation set up by the German government to finance the discontinuation of coal mining in the Ruhr region, has sold its remaining shares in Stadler Rail, the Swiss maker of rolling stock, via an accelerated bookbuild on Monday evening.
